There Tamaya Uchi Komurasaki, Kôchô, Haruji, emblematic work of the Japanese master Kitagawa Utamaro, is a masterpiece that embodies the elegance and finesse of Ukiyo-e art, a flourishing style at the time of Edo. Created between 1793 and 1804, this famous print highlighted female beauty, capturing the very essence of grace and delicacy. Utamaro, through his portraits, was able to transmit deep emotions, establishing an intimate link between the spectator and the characters represented.

This work, in addition to its visual impact, offers a poignant reflection of the Japanese society of its time, aroused reflections on culture and aesthetics.
